The Five Best Tea Houses in Mumbai

Mocha1. Tea Centre: Located at Churchgate, this place is considered as a `Tea Drinkers` famous joint, offers everything for the tea drinkers. Their tea Bazaar sells products like the `Masala Tea` and even a specialty tea, which sells for a few thousands, per kilo! This is an ideal place for the people who want a classy ambience and a great service.

2. Cha Bar: Situated outside the Oxford Bookstore at Churchgate, this place is a black and white tea spot! The very name spells out the magic of Chai all around! They serve teas like the Chai Hindustani, Purple Rose and also the cultural preparations like the Arabic Spice, Kashmiri Qahwa and the Ladhaki Cha.

3. Poush: Located in Andheri, this is the only authentic Kashmiri eatery in Mumbai, where the qahwa is served here. This special Kashmiri tea is made from tealeaves brought down from Jammu, sugar, almonds, a tinge of cinnamon and cardamom.

4. Mocha: This place located at Bandra though serves a variety of coffee, but the `Masala Chai` served here is very famous and has got its unique flavour from the spices that go in its making.

5. Koolar & Co Restaurant: This Irani Eatery was started over 75 years ago, this place is very famous for its Irani Tea, bun pav and various other eateries.
